Transaction 91bedbecb3fce1693567cc5a820b35084122496d2dde2b051208caac12e355e5
1 Input
1 Output
-
91bedbecb3fce1693567cc5a820b35084122496d2dde2b051208caac12e355e5:0
- value
- 88086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 97bb02e1074f5e2d0d91f1ac5a581a22694a9af9 OP_EQUAL
- address
- 3FXHzH9ueGWjffdovuRzrUBFEYbikmqon8